Lifeboats, part 1

There is an almost invisible piece of technology, which might suddenly become very important for the growing industry of LEO space stations. The part which was considered before, then got "simplified out", and in the ISS period it was made operationally redundant - and so, to save funds, indefinitely shelved. But with new commercial offerings coming, and everything being different and therefore many things questioned, it might be thrust into the limelight again.

I'm talking about lifeboats.

The concept is familiar, just like the name - we used to have miscellaneous, smaller ships onboard of larger ocean-faring vessels for the purposes of extra safety - so if something happens with the big ship, like it did with Titanic, we'd have smaller ships readily available to help us reach a safe shore. Just like that, in a large space station, if something really bad happens in space, we'd like to have an option of evacuate the station, and reach safety with some smaller vehicles. NASA had a program, CRV/X-38, where the vehicle was intended to serve as the lifeboat for ISS. This program was cancelled in 2002, it was considered too expensive and at the same time Soyuz-TMA vehicle was conveniently available, so there was no immediate need for a dedicated lifeboat. The lifeboat is needed if the vehicle which brought the crew to the station leaves, and the crew remains on the station. But with retirement of the Space Shuttle in 2011 there was no vehicle which wasn't able to just stay at the station - first it was Soyuz, and then, after 2020, SpaceX's Crew Dragon was added to the role as well. So, if we always have the vehicle which we arrived in available, we don't need a lifeboat - to leave, we can just use the same spacecraft we came in.

There are drawbacks for this approach though. For example, both Soyuz and Crew Dragon have some limited mission time - they can't indefinitely hang in space. Crew Dragon is reusable, but while serving on ISS, it can't fly other crew - it's busy on the station. For reasons like that it might be useful to reconsider an option of having dedicated lifeboats on a new station being built, and use the crew transport as just the transport.

Lifeboats can be optimized to stay in space for long time, way longer than today's capsules. Lifeboats don't need some features of standalone spaceships - e.g., they don't need to fly to space with people onboard, so e.g. flight abort system isn't needed. All resources to maintain readiness on orbit can come from the station - thermal, electrical, some communications, so the lifeboat itself might be cheaper. It could be better integrated with the station. For example, if we want to bring people to the station on a modern equivalent of the Space Shuttle - like Starship - it's harder to justify keeping that multifunctional and large spaceship continuously attached to the station. So, when a station is designed from scratch, the option of lifeboats surfaces again.
